Rota slipstreams. Courtesy of Mr Jibberingloon at NCB Motorsport. They are 15" 8j Et20. That should sort the 'sunken wheels' look I have on the Enkies. I'll swap them when the salt goes away and the Enkies will be stored away as winter tyres.
